Along with the number of miles tracked on components, could we see the number of hours? There are bike components (like shocks and forks) that have service intervals in hours, not miles.

Related is a feature request for tracking maintenance. That would be great. But a simple 'hours' feature alongside miles would be a good start.

I'd really like this. Mtb shock/fork services are determined by hours, not mileage. You can go by "seasons" but not everyone rides 1000's of miles a year. And those who do that mileage could probably benefit from more than 1 rebuild per season. It'd just be easier to gauge service life.
